One of the main advantages of Tractor Camera systems is their ability to provide real-time views of the field from the tractor cab. This allows farmers to closely monitor the progress of their work, ensuring that tasks are completed accurately and efficiently. By having a clear view of the field, farmers can identify any potential issues or obstacles that may affect productivity, such as pests, disease, or irrigation problems. This proactive approach helps to prevent problems before they escalate, ultimately leading to higher yields and profits.
Another key benefit of tractor camera systems is their ability to improve navigation and precision farming practices. Many of these systems are equipped with GPS technology, allowing farmers to create accurate field maps, track their progress, and optimize their routes. This precision enables farmers to reduce overlaps and gaps in field work, minimizing waste of resources such as seeds, fertilizers, and fuel. By utilizing tractor camera systems, farmers can also implement variable rate technology, where inputs are adjusted based on specific areas of the field to maximize efficiency and reduce costs.
Furthermore, tractor camera systems contribute to increased safety on the farm. By providing a clear view of the surroundings, farmers can avoid accidents involving obstacles, equipment, or personnel. This enhanced visibility is especially important when operating large machinery in tight spaces or challenging terrains. In addition, some tractor camera systems are equipped with sensors that can detect objects or people within a certain range, alerting the operator to potential hazards. With improved safety features, farmers can work confidently and reduce the risk of accidents and injuries.
The versatility of tractor camera systems makes them valuable tools for a variety of agricultural tasks. Whether planting, spraying, harvesting, or cultivating, these systems can be integrated into various stages of the farming process, increasing efficiency and productivity. For example, tractor cameras can be used to monitor seed depth during planting, ensuring uniform germination and stand establishment. They can also assist in applying pesticides or herbicides precisely, reducing the impact on non-target areas and minimizing environmental risks. By incorporating tractor camera systems into their practices, farmers can streamline their operations and achieve better outcomes in less time.
In addition to their practical benefits, tractor camera systems also offer data collection and analysis capabilities. By capturing images and videos of the field, farmers can gather valuable information about crop conditions, growth patterns, and yields. This data can be used to make informed decisions about planting schedules, irrigation needs, and pest management strategies. With the help of advanced software and analytics tools, farmers can analyze the data collected from tractor camera systems to identify trends, patterns, and areas for improvement. This valuable insight can lead to more efficient farming practices, higher yields, and better resource management.
